Earlier Report Observations

From 2018 to 2020, the frozen vegetables market in Western Asia grew in volume from 333 thousand tons to 379 thousand tons, while its value increased from $439 million to $503 million. The expansion in 2020 coincided with the growth of the food processing industry in the region, which boosted demand for processed vegetables including frozen varieties. Improved export capabilities from key supplying countries also contributed to greater market availability and competition.

After a temporary contraction in 2021 to 363 thousand tons in volume and $454 million in value, likely a post-pandemic adjustment, the market rebounded strongly in 2022 to 440 thousand tons and $585 million. This recovery was partly driven by the launch of new frozen vegetable products in the Asia-Pacific region, stimulating consumer interest and broadening the product range available to the market.

By 2023, market volume had moderated to 382 thousand tons, yet its value continued to rise, reaching $596 million, indicating sustained price growth. This trend reflects the broader improvement in the quality and competitiveness of frozen vegetables in global trade, supported by the expansion of regional food industries and stronger export performance from major producers.

Western Asia's frozen vegetable production has increased for the third consecutive year. In 2020, the region produced 225.5 thousand tonnes of frozen vegetables, marking a 15.7% rise from the previous year. Over the period from 2017 to 2020, production grew by 27.4%, with an average annual growth rate of 8.4%.

Western Asia's frozen vegetable production value has also risen for the third year in a row. In 2020, the output was valued at 344.7 million US dollars, representing a 5.6% year-on-year increase. Between 2017 and 2020, production value increased by 15.5%, equating to an annualized growth rate of 4.9%.

Exports frozen vegetables from Western Asia

Exports in kind, K t

After a two-year decline, frozen vegetable exports from Western Asia rebounded in 2020. The region exported 66.5 thousand tonnes, showing a significant 15.7% increase compared to 2019. Over the 2017-2020 period, exports grew by 5.5%, with an annualized rate of 1.8%. The lowest export volume was recorded in 2019 at 57.5 thousand tonnes, which saw the largest decline of 8.5%.

The export market for frozen vegetables in kind from Western Asia was diverse between 2017 and 2020. The United States (17.3% of exports), Germany (10.6%), and the United Kingdom (10.5%) together accounted for only 38.4% of total flows, while the remaining 61.6% was distributed among numerous other countries.

In 2020, foreign frozen vegetable supplies from Western Asia amounted to 101.7 million US dollars, a 5.6% increase from 2019. However, over the 2017-2020 period, exports decreased by 4.3%, with an average annual decline of 1.5%. The lowest value was recorded in 2019 at 96.3 million US dollars, while the peak was in 2018 at 109.8 million US dollars. The largest decline occurred in 2019, with a drop of 12.3%.

Imports frozen vegetables to Western Asia

Imports in kind, K t

In 2020, cross-border shipments of frozen vegetables to Western Asia reached 220.3 thousand tonnes, a 12.8% increase from the previous year. Between 2017 and 2020, imports grew by 15.9%, with an annualized rate of 5.1%. The largest decline was recorded in 2019, with an 8.3% drop.

Frozen vegetable imports to Western Asia have increased for the third consecutive year. In 2020, imports reached 260.4 million US dollars, a strong 11.1% gain compared to 2019. Over the 2017-2020 period, imports rose by 13.6%, equating to an annualized growth rate of 4.3%.

From 2017 to 2020, the partner structure for frozen vegetable imports in value terms was balanced rather than concentrated. Egypt (20.9% of imports), Belgium (19.8%), and Spain (7.6%) jointly represented 48.3% of total flows, with many other countries accounting for the remaining 51.7%.
